Security Basics
I wanted to give a brief, yet hopefully informative, little
guide on internet security and how to protect yourself online.
There are three major areas that I'm going to cover:
-
Updating Windows
-
Firewalls
-
Antivirus Software
Updating Windows is the first suggestion that I would have for
you. When you installed your brand new Windows operating
system they didn't have all the bugs worked out of it and they
issue updates for your operating system. These updates
will fix many of the security holes that were found in the original
operating system. So, how do you go about updating your
Windows? Go to
http://windowsupdate.microsoft.com/
and click on the link that says product
update to the left. Microsoft will quickly scan your computer,
see what version of Windows you have and what patches you have
missing. It will give you a long list of files that have
to be updated and its a long tedious task to update, trust me,
lots of installing, rebooting, going back to the website, getting
the next element, etc. This however is the most important
thing you can do to increase the security of your computer.
These updates will fix known exploits or holes in your system.
Trust me, they know about these holes in the system because
hackers have found the holes and used them in various exploits.
So Update! Update! Update!
Next suggestion is a firewall, with the ever increasing number
of people with a broadband connection and 24/7 connectivity
it becomes even more important that you put a firewall on you
computer. Your computer has a series of ports that are
either opened or closed to receive and send information onto
the net. If someone attacks these ports with D.O.S. (Denial
of Service) attack they can shut your connection to the net
off, but that's not that bad, but they can also look at these
open ports and find openings in your computer. This is
serious because they can gather information on you, can look
into you hard drive, and do all sorts of malicious activities.

The third and final suggestion is Antivirus software.
Viruses can range in severity from something simple and annoying
to viruses that will wipe your hard drive clean. So you
need to get an Antivirus software program. AVG is a free
virus scanner that works excellently at protecting your computer.
Read more about the antivirus software at the Antivirus
section of this website. Antivirus software will also
help prevent Trojans from getting on you computer. Trojans
allows a user to have remote access to your computer, yes, just
like the trojan horse it sits on your computer waiting for the
person that put it there to use it...so antivirus software will
work wonders on your computer. Make sure you keep the
virus definitions up to date! Also avoid downloading email
attachments, downloading files from an untrustworthy site, and
make sure you frequently scan you hard drive.
